Will Young is synonymous with 00s Britain, having won the first series of Pop Idol in 2002.
Through the show, Will, now 46, earned pop superstar status with his debut track Anything is Possible, and with his nine albums that followed, he became a household name and LGBTQ+ legend.
While many fans will recall the huge explosion of media interest when he came out as gay shortly after the show, if it were to happen today, Will is happy to say no one would care.
'I mean, it's like chalk and cheese now,' Will tells Metro this Pride Month. 'I don't often really remember the sort of mini traumas that would occur being openly gay and a public figure in the early 2000s. It was so different then.'
Will, then, a charming 22-year-old adjusting his eyes to the spotlight, wouldn't have thought it was possible to be where we are in 2025.
'There was no legal support, you couldn't get married. You just operated within how it was then, which was like, 'Well, I'm going to get shouted out, I'm going to get threatened. No one's gonna care.' That was a given, which seems bonkers now to think like that,' he says.
When Will reflects on this time, he does so with even more respect for those who came before him in the 80s and 90s; the likes of singer Jimmy Somerville, Erasure's Andy Bell, Pet Shop Boys star Neil Tennant, and actor Ian McKellen.

'We have to remember those people and those before them, because they were pretty seminal,' Will says.
Our chat comes just as the international human rights group ILGA-Europe ranked 49 countries on their legal and policy practices for LGBTQ+ people.
The results found the UK, twice top of the ranking in 2011 and 2015, has dropped to 22nd, from 16th place last year.
Has Will noticed this shift?
'Wow, that's so interesting,' he says, thinking: 'I mean, I don't think I have… That rather surprises me. But it wouldn't surprise me if it was focusing on the T part of that.' More Trending
Here, Will refers to the treatment of the trans community in the UK, who are often the subject of intense political scrutiny and are more likely to be subject to harassment and violence than cis people.
'You know, that's just horrific,' Will says of the UK's treatment of trans people, with a twang of exasperation.
'That's horrific across the board, how it's been politicised. It's ridiculous. It's 0.5% of people, and it's but it's always in the top 10 of anything political. It's typical marginalisation.'
Will's advocacy knows no bounds, and he recently revealed how he's considering fostering children or becoming a school counsellor, putting his parental instincts to good use.

Ross Marshall (Alex Walkinshaw) has finally flipped over Joel's (Max Murray) disgusting behaviour in EastEnders. It became immediately clear when the father and son arrived in Walford alongside Vicki Fowler (Alice Haig) earlier this year that they were hiding a fair few skeletons in their closet. They couldn't return to their home in Australia, as Joel had upskirted a pupil in his class, and Ross had paid her family $50,000 in exchange for their silence. He's since enacted havoc on the residents of Albert Square, impregnating Avani Nandra-Hart (Aaliyah James) and introducing new mate Tommy Moon (Sonny Kendall) to dangerous adult content online. Later, Joel showed Tommy videos made by a disgusting influencer, who degrades women. Joel thought this was an appropriate way to talk about the opposite sex, branding his own mum a 'slapper', talking about how she abandoned him as a child. He also sexually assaulted a passenger on the London Underground in an utterly vile move, with Vicki paying off the victim. Earlier this week, Joel discovered some big news about his estranged mother Cleo, that left him reeling. Other than Joel's derogatory comments about his mum, we don't know an awful lot about her. She contacted Ross to inform him that she was remarrying, and despite us finally finding out her name, fans are still convinced that she is none other than Zoe Slater (Michelle Ryan), using a pseudonym. This was fuelled by him yelling: 'Well, you ain't my mum, you don't get to tell me what to do!' during a row with Vicki, which seemed to echo a very famous 'Enders quote. As long-term fans will remember, back in 2005, Zoe screamed: 'You can't tell me what to do, you ain't my mother!', as her mum Kat (Jessie Wallace) howled back: 'Yes I am!' Joel's version coincidentally aired in the same week that Zoe returned after 20 years. Well, rather unsurprisingly, he hasn't taken it well. As we saw, he headed to The Vic to catch up with Tommy – and suggested they make things more exciting by stealing some booze from the barrel store. It didn't take long for the lads to be discovered, and Ross dragged Joel home. As he was being carted out of the pub he spurted a number of derogatory and extremely concerning comments about Kat. Back at home, Ross made another worrying discovery… In tonight's episode, Ross attempted to worm his way into Joel's mindset and learn the extent of his issues. Joel told his dad that as a man he has no rights, and continued to tear strips off Kat. Ross was at a loose end with what to say, and suggested they have a beer together and a heart to heart. An afternoon with Aaron Dingle (Danny Miller) led to Vinny Dingle (Bradley Johnson) making a very honest confession in Emmerdale. Vinny's head has been in a right mess ever since he tried to kiss his friend Kammy Hadiq (Shebz Miah). In the immediate aftermath, Vinny tried to tell Kammy it was a joke, but was actually left terribly confused about how it made him feel. Kammy has attempted to help Vinny talk through his feelings, but he's been quite defensive about it and has remained adamant his heart belongs with Gabby Thomas (Rosie Bentham). Yesterday, Vinny allowed himself a brief moment to not live in denial while spending time with Kammy again. At the scrapyard, Kammy gave Vinny a watch as a gift ahead of his wedding. He was touched and went to put it in the office as Kammy searched for items for his car. As Vinny watched his pal through the window, he started gazing at him lustfully. It was perhaps this interaction that prompted Vinny to be vulnerable in a chat with Aaron in this evening's episode. At the flat, as they battled some DIY, Aaron told Vinny that he kissed Robert Sugden (Ryan Hawley) on his wedding day. Moments later, Vinny told Aaron that he recently tried to kiss someone as well. ITV's The Fortune Hotel features ten pairs of contestants who compete to find a briefcase containing £250,000 while avoiding one with an 'Early Checkout' card. Daily challenges determine what order the players keep or swap their briefcase. Will you be watching The Fortune Hotel season two? At the end of each day, pairs gather to decide whether to keep their current briefcase or swap it with another. The ultimate aim is to correctly identify the money-filled briefcase and hold onto it until the end to win the £250,000 prize. The first season of The Fortune Hotel provided some high quality drama last year. The winners of the gameshow were Jo-Anne and Will, a mother and son duo. They took home a cool £210,000 after successfully navigating the game and outwitting the other contestants. The duo did, however, give some of their prize money away to Aysha and Sam after many viewers felt they became villains of the show after playing dirty. The Fortune Hotel 2025 will be filmed at the stunning Silversands Grenada resort in the Caribbean. More Trending The resort is located on Grand Anse Beach and features private villas, a spa and multiple dining options. It is known for its 100-meter-long infinity pool and luxurious atmosphere.
